De acordo com as Leis 12.965/2014 e 13.709/2018, que regulam o uso da Internet e o tratamento de dados pessoais no Brasil, ao me inscrever na newsletter do portal DICAS-L, autorizo o envio de notificações por e-mail ou outros meios e declaro estar ciente e concordar com seus Termos de Uso e Política de Privacidade.

Configurando a velocidade de sua placa de rede

Colaboração: Rodrigo Pace de Barros

Data de Publicação: 15 de Setembro de 2006

Configurar a velocidade em que uma placa de rede funciona é simples. Para fazê-lo em ambientes que utilizem RedHat (ou sistemas operacionais provenientes dele, como o CentOS), deve-se utilizar o comanto ethtool da seguinte forma:

Como root, digite:

  ethtool -s <Placa> speed <Veloc> duplex <Multplx> autoneg <on|off>

onde

  • <Placa>: Placa de rede que se deseja alterar a velocidade.

  • <Veloc>: Velocidade utilizada nesta configuração. Pode ser 10/100 e até 1000 dependendo da placa. Normalmente coloca-se off quando a configuração original da placa é alterada.

  • <Multplx>: Indica se a placa trabalhará em half-duplex ou full-duplex. Para configurarmos como full-duplex, utilize a string "duplex". Para configurar como half-duplex, utilize a string "half".

  • <on|off>: indica se a placa terá a capacidade de auto negociar a sua velocidade com o switch. Normalmente utiliza-se o "off" quando alteramos as configurações de velocidade e multiplexação da placa.

Assim, caso seja necessário configurar a placa eth0 em 100 full-duplex, utilze o comando:

  ethtool -s eth0 speed 100 duplex full autoneg off

Para que estas configurações sejam permanentes no sistema, deve-se editar o arquivo de configuração que gerencia estas informações.

Acesse o diretório onde os arquivos de configuração das placas de rede se encontram:

  # cd /etc/sysconfig/network-scripts

Dentro deste diretório existirá um arquivo por interface de rede. Assim, caso você tenha em seu computador 2 interfaces "eth", você terá os seguintes arquivos:

  • ifcfg-eth0
  • ifcfg-eth1

Claro que existirá o arquivo para a interface de loopback, denominada "ifcfg-lo". Porém esta não será vista aqui.

Para configurar a velocidade nas placas de rede, edite o arquivo desejado:

  # vi ifcfg-eth0

e insira nele a seguinte linha:

  ETHTOOL_OPTS="autoneg <no|off> speed <Veloc> duplex <Multplx>"

Assim, caso seja necessário configurar a placa eth0 em 100 full-duplex, utilze a string:

  ETHTOOL_OPTS="autoneg off speed 100 duplex full"

Adicionar comentário

* Campos obrigatórios
5000
Powered by Commentics

Comentários

Nenhum comentário ainda. Seja o primeiro!


Veja a relação completa dos artigos de Rodrigo Pace de Barros